Pros: Cheap price.
Work just fine and are fast.
Perfect for small planes.
Long servo wire.
Comes with a variety of servo arms.

Cons: None really.

Other Thoughts: These are similar to the mystery servos. The wire on these are a bit longer. The servo arms on these are not compatible with the mystery 9g servos for those wondering.
Deal extreme sells smaller servos as well.
Buy a couple. It's always good to have some extras on hand so you don't have to yank servos out of your other planes.

Pros: + Oh so cheap! Buy 5 as the bulkrate makes it the same price as if you bought 4
+ Clear lets you know if a gear is broken later on.
+ Blue is a classy color, but if you don't like it you can paint over it to make it whatever color you like.
+ Included control horns and screws are useful too.
+ Length on the servo wire is above average for a micro servo.
+ Very fast, with very little overshoot. I would say they are at least as fast as any other non-brushless servo.

Cons: - Was very oily out of the bag
- One of them had no grease inside the gears.

Other Thoughts: Wow, these are fast. They also overshoot very little, compared with other servos that I have used. Overshoot is what you call when the servo goes too far, and then has to come back a little bit to get to the real position. These maybe overshoot 1-2mm.
Also, I like blue. So I left them as is. However, some guys don't like that and they paint them black... I don't recommend that, as you will never get the paint to stick very well. plus, how can you see when a gear is stripped?
